Description

David Bowie needs no introduction. An immense star whose music and writing has transcended generations he remains one of the most articulate influencers of modern music. Over fifty years his singles and albums have slid up and down the bestseller charts, adapting to the changing times, exploring new musical themes, always pushing at boundaries in a desperate desire to seek out the new and the different. This fantastic new, unofficial biography covers his life, music, art and movies, with a sweep of incredible photographs. Author Biography:

As author or editor of eighteen books Sean Egan has written books on The Rolling Stones, The Beatles, Coronation Street, Leonardo DiCaprio, Tarzan and Manchester United Football Club. Written extensively for rock magazines, from Classic Rock to Vox, and CD sleevenotes for Mercury, Sanctuary, Factory and more. With two decades of experience in entertainment journalism, Malcolm Mackenzie (foreword) knows pop culture. He successfully launched the teen magazine, We Love Pop in 2011, winning a BSME award for Best Editor. He also launched Oh My Vlog, a magazine for the influencer generation to global fanfare. Between writing books on K-Pop, BTS, Friends and Ariana Grande, he regularly contributes to the Guardian, GQ, Grazia and Glamour... basically anything with a ā€˜Gā€™.
